Fig. 2 shows high resolution xps core level spectra of the metallic copper (upper row), cu 2 o (middle row) and cuo (bottom row) reference samples. the high resolution cu 2p spectrum of metallic copper in fig. 2 a can be deconvoluted into two sharp peaks at binding energies (be) of 932.6 ev and 952.4 ev, which are assigned to the cu 2p 3 2 cu 2p 1 2 doublet, respectively.
